Here’s a breakdown of the data from the provided text, focusing on the key issue and details:
Problem:
* Users of the Samsung Galaxy watch 4 Classic are reporting issues after updating to One UI 8.0.
* The watch is failing to detect when it’s being worn on a wrist.
Impact:
* This wrist detection failure disables crucial health features:
* ECG (Electrocardiogram)
* BIA (bioelectrical Impedance Analysis) – for body composition measurements.
